The video tutorial explores real-life English through the process of making an apple pie. It covers the pronunciation of 'caramel', the conversational use of 'OK', and various expressions for joking. The tutorial also delves into common reductions in American English and phrasal verbs related to pie making. The video concludes with a tasting session and links to additional content.
